I have a worksheet that records feedback from a training session. The
feedback can be ether strongly agree,, disagree or strongly disagree. I have used a countif function to count how many of each type of response is received and then based a chart on the results. This works fine however using Auto filter I now need to filter the full list to so that I can compare feedback between trainers or location or training units etc. When I filter the list, my COUNTIF still counts hidden rows. My question is.... is there a function like COUNTIF that will only count non filtered items or any other suggestions on how to solve the problem. Thanks |
